
	div.faq h2 {
		font-size				: 11px;
		margin-left				: 10px;
		display					: inline;
		padding					: 0px 5px 0px 25px;
		background				: #ffffff url(/images/arrow_blue_unfold.gif) 7px 1px no-repeat;
	}
	
	div.faq p {
		padding					: 8px 0px;
	}
	
	div.faq .group {
		margin-top				: 10px;
	}
	
	div.faq .group p {
		padding					: 0px 8px 8px 8px;
		border					: solid 1px #d6d6d6;
		border-width			: 0px 1px;
	}
	
	div.faq .group .first {
		padding-top				: 8px;
	}
	
	div.faq .group .toc {
		padding					: 6px 8px 2px 8px;
		border-top				: solid 1px #d6d6d6;
		text-align				: right;
	}
	
	div.faq table {
		width					: 100%;
		padding-bottom			: 8px;
		border					: solid 1px #d6d6d6;
		border-width			: 0px 1px;
	}
	
	div.faq th {
		text-align				: left;
	}
	
	div.faq table .cat {
		width					: 100px;
		padding					: 2px 8px;
	}
	
	div.faq ul, div.faq ol {
		padding					: 0px 0px 8px 35px;
	}
	
	div.faq .group ul, div.faq .group ol {
		border					: solid 1px #d6d6d6;
		border-width			: 0px 1px;
	}
	
	div.faq ol li {
		list-style: decimal outside;
	}
	
	div.faq li.container {
		list-style: none outside;
	}
	
	
	div.faq ul li {
		list-style: disc outside;
	}

